Sheeri: In a shocking incident, a person claimed to have killed his daughter and later dumped her body in the forest area of Laridora Narvaw Sheeri in north Kashmir’s Baramulla district, Tuesday.
Sources said that one Javid Ahmad Khan son of Rehmatullah Khan of Laridora Sheeri Narvwa took his daughter along from his home early in the morning.
Khan later killed his daughter dumped her body in the forest area after which he is said to have informed a local and also went to inform police station Chandoosa about the crimes he had committed.
Following the information, police, along with locals, searched the forest area and recovered the dead body.
A case has been registered in the matter and the accused is in police custody. Police has started investigation in the matter.
